Sure.   Ive tried mouse both on my pc, and my chromebook.   Pc is an i5-7400 , 8gb ram, gtx1060 Chromebook is a brand new asus c434 flipbook   Ive tried several different mice both wored and wireless (wireless being a razer atheris)   Ive tried every fix i could  find on reddit and elsewhere regarding pointer lock, mouse polling speed, cursor speed setting on chromebook, and all the hardware accelleration and other flags within chrome that everyone said to try. The mouse response is either sluggish or extremely over sensitive.   Best way i can describe it is, when you are trying to be precise, for example aiming at something at a distance, your cursor/recticle feels like its dragging through water. When your try snap turns. Like in destiny, a shotgun slide around a corner. If you try to mive your aim 30 degrees to the right as you slide around the corner it will over accellerate, and jump 90 degrees or more instead.   I can try and get some game footage i  private matches tonight and post them somewhere to show the difference if need be.  Ive played destiny 2 on pc since forsaken came out. Im well used to how snappy and crisp and perfect aiming is on pc. So its super disheartening to feel forced to use a controller because it responds better than a mouse and keyboard does. By comparison both the stadia controller on wifi with ccu, or wired to the pc or chromebook. As well as a ps4 dualshock (bluetooth to pc) and wired to chromebook.they both respond flawlessly. Especially when doing any pvp or pinnacle activities involving precision. (Crucible, gambit, raiding etc)   For just grinding strikes, or menagerie or general questing, meh whatever controller i can deal with.    But one of the things that sold myself and many ithers on stadia was being able to use mouse as well if we so choose. Right now, there is no choice really.   I know a few that suck it up and deal with the crappy mosue response figuring it to be better overall than the controller.  But with things like trials of osiris coming back, sure would be nice to use the product as advertised and be able to shoot properly with a mouse.
